Considering that cash customers are bearing the prices, threats, and financial investment themselves, they normally pay a little less than the residential property's leading market worth.


That lower cash rate likewise suggests that the customer purchases your house "as-is", foregoing any kind of formal home assessments. So the danger of any type of repair services or updates the home needs, recognized or unidentified, drop from the seller to the buyer. Money deals are a win-win situation for both sides. Since money purchases avoid much of the red tape involved with home loan approvals, the entire process is much faster and easier for vendors.


In return, sellers that prepare to shut quickly might be more responsive to buyers who offer cash money and agree to negotiate much better terms or pricing.
